日志分析工具,提升系统运维效率的利器

Lunvps
pENeBMn.png
在当今数字化时代,系统日志数据量呈指数级增长。日志分析工具作为IT运维和业务分析的重要助手,能够帮助我们从海量日志中提取有价值的信息,发现系统异常,优化业务流程。本文将详细介绍日志分析工具的核心功能、主流产品、应用场景及选型建议,助您找到最适合的日志管理解决方案。
日志分析工具,提升系统运维效率的利器
(图片来源网络,侵删)

日志分析工具的基本概念

日志分析工具是指专门用于收集、存储、分析和可视化系统日志数据的软件解决方案。这些工具能够处理来自服务器、应用程序、网络设备等各种来源的日志信息。现代日志分析工具通常具备实时处理能力,可以快速识别异常模式,并通过可视化仪表板直观展示分析结果。在安全领域,日志分析工具更是检测入侵行为、追踪安全事件的重要武器。随着云计算和微服务架构的普及,日志分析工具的重要性愈发凸显,成为企业IT基础设施中不可或缺的组成部分。

主流日志分析工具比较

市场上存在多种日志分析工具,各有特色。Elastic Stack(ELK)是最流行的开源解决方案之一,由Elasticsearch、Logstash和Kibana组成,具有强大的搜索和分析能力。Splunk是商业产品中的佼佼者,提供企业级功能和卓越的用户体验。Graylog作为新兴的开源工具,在易用性方面表现突出。对于云原生环境,Loki与Grafana的组合提供了轻量级的替代方案。商业产品如Sumo Logic和Datadog则提供了更全面的SaaS服务。企业在选择时需要考虑日志量、分析需求、预算和技术栈等因素。

日志分析工具的核心功能

  • 日志收集与聚合
  • 优秀的日志分析工具需要具备强大的收集能力,能够从各种来源(文件、syslog、API等)获取日志数据。现代系统通常采用代理(Agent)方式部署收集器,如Filebeat、Fluentd等。工具还需要支持日志的缓冲和聚合,以应对高峰期的数据涌入。分布式部署能力对于大规模环境尤为重要,可以避免单点故障。

  • 实时分析与告警
  • 实时处理是日志分析工具的关键价值所在。通过流式处理技术,工具可以在日志产生时就进行分析,及时发现异常。基于规则的告警机制能够在检测到特定模式(如错误激增、安全事件)时立即通知运维人员。更先进的工具还支持机器学习算法,能够自动识别异常模式,减少误报和漏报。

    日志分析工具的应用场景

    在故障排查方面,日志分析工具可以快速定位系统问题的根源,大大缩短平均修复时间(MTTR)。性能监控场景中,通过分析应用程序日志可以识别性能瓶颈和优化机会。安全领域,日志分析是SIEM(安全信息和事件管理)系统的核心组件,用于检测入侵、审计合规性。业务分析方面,用户行为日志可以帮助产品团队理解用户旅程,优化产品体验。在DevOps实践中,日志分析更是实现可观测性的三大支柱之一。

    日志分析工具的未来发展趋势

    随着技术演进,日志分析工具正朝着更智能、更集成的方向发展。AI和机器学习技术的应用将使工具具备更强的异常检测和根因分析能力。云原生架构的普及推动了对轻量级、Kubernetes友好工具的需求。边缘计算场景需要能够在资源受限环境中运行的日志分析解决方案。数据隐私法规的加强也促使工具提供更精细的访问控制和数据脱敏功能。未来,日志分析可能会与其他可观测性信号(指标、追踪)更深度整合,提供更全面的系统视图。

    日志分析工具已成为现代IT运维不可或缺的助手。无论是开源解决方案如ELK Stack,还是商业产品如Splunk,都能帮助组织从海量日志数据中提取价值。在选择工具时,需要综合考虑功能需求、技术栈、团队技能和预算等因素。随着技术的不断发展,日志分析工具将变得更加智能和易用,为企业的数字化转型提供更强有力的支持。

    常见问题解答

  • Q:小型团队应该如何选择日志分析工具?
  • A:对于小型团队,建议从开源工具如ELK Stack或Graylog开始,它们功能强大且社区支持良好。如果资源有限,可以考虑SaaS化的日志服务,避免维护基础设施的负担。

  • Q:日志分析工具如何处理数据隐私问题?
  • A:现代日志分析工具通常提供数据脱敏、访问控制、加密存储等功能。企业应根据合规要求配置适当的策略,特别是处理包含PII(个人身份信息)的日志时。

  • Q:日志数据量很大,如何控制存储成本?
  • A:可以采用日志分级策略,重要日志长期保存,普通日志短期保存后归档或删除。压缩技术和冷热数据分层存储也能显著降低成本。

  • Q:如何提高日志分析的有效性?
  • A:建议制定统一的日志规范,确保日志结构化和可解析。设置合理的告警阈值,避免告警疲劳。定期审查分析规则,根据业务变化调整监控重点。

  • Q:日志分析与APM(应用性能监控)工具有何区别?
  • A:日志分析工具主要处理文本日志,而APM工具专注于性能指标和调用追踪。两者互补,现代可观测性平台往往整合了这两种能力。

    pENeBMn.png
    文章版权声明:除非注明,否则均为论主机评测网原创文章,转载或复制请以超链接形式并注明出处。

    相关阅读

  • 高防服务器是为了抵御各种网络攻击(如DDoS攻击、CC攻击等)而特别加固的服务器。以下是对高防服务器的一些评测要点
  • 高防日本服务器通常指的是部署在日本、具备高级防御能力的服务器。这类服务器不仅提供稳定的网络环境,还具备防御DDoS攻击、CC攻击等网络威胁的能力。以下是一些关于高防日本服务器的关键信息和考虑因素
  • 高防服务器通常指的是具备高级防御能力的服务器,用于抵御各种网络攻击,如DDoS攻击、CC攻击等。而怎么打可能指的是如何配置和使用这样的服务器来应对攻击。以下是一些建议的步骤和策略
  • 成都高防服务器租用主要涉及到一些提供高防御能力的服务器租赁服务,这些服务器通常部署在数据中心,并配备有高级的防火墙和安全系统,以保护客户的数据和应用程序免受网络攻击。
  • 国外高防服务器通常指的是部署在国外的、具备高级防御能力的服务器。这类服务器通常用于托管网站、应用或其他网络服务,并具备抵御各种网络攻击(如DDoS攻击、CC攻击等)的能力。
  • 高防美国服务器通常指的是部署在美国的高防御服务器,这类服务器具备更强的安全防护能力,以抵御各种网络攻击,如DDoS攻击、CC攻击等。以下是一些关于高防美国服务器的关键信息和考虑因素
  • 高防CDN和高防服务器都是网络安全领域的产品,旨在保护网站和应用免受恶意攻击,如DDoS攻击、CC攻击等。它们之间的主要区别在于部署方式、防护能力和使用场景。
  • 高防服务器租用主要涉及到对服务器进行特殊的安全防护,以抵御各种网络攻击,如DDoS攻击、CC攻击等。这种服务器通常配备有高性能的防火墙和流量清洗设备,以确保在遭受攻击时仍能保持稳定的运行。
  • pENeBMn.png

    目录[+]